[n] an act of hindering someone's plans or efforts
[n] a feeling of annoyance at being hindered or criticized; "her constant complaints were the main source of his frustration"
[n] the feeling that accompanies an experience of being thwarted in attaining your goals

defeat, foiling, thwarting

